Maximum capability with bidirectional communication
6 visible and 6 near-infrared (NIR) laser channels. The internal NIR light source can replace the external OLS module for combined operation.
Infrared wavelengths (1310nm, 1550nm) carry data between transmit and receive devices, enabling remote control and OTDR trace viewing.
Full 12-port identification using encoded visible wavelengths (488nm, 520nm, 638nm) via DMX512 protocol.
Combined visible identification and infrared data/test capabilities in a single device — reducing the need for separate OLS module.
| Ports | 12 (6 visible + 6 NIR) |
| Visible wavelengths | 488nm, 520nm, 638nm |
| IR wavelengths | 1310nm, 1550nm |
| Internal OLS | Yes (replaces external OLS) |
| Bidirectional | Yes (via IR channel) |
| Protocol | DMX512 with RDM |
| Power | Rechargeable battery |
The FCM-12VIR is the maximum-capability VisiMap Fiber Control Module. It combines 6 visible laser channels for encoded identification with 6 near-infrared channels for bidirectional data communication. The internal NIR light source can replace the need for an external OLS module, and the infrared channel enables remote control and OTDR trace viewing when paired with the CCM.
Long-haul deployments, combined visible/NIR operation, maximum system capability
